Certification and Licensure
The Association for Behavior Analysis International has verified courses in this program toward the coursework requirements for eligibility to sit for the Board-Certified Behavior Analyst® examination.
Students interested in a career in applied behavior analysis should be aware of the two primary credentials that are often needed: board certified behavior analyst (BCBA) and licensed behavior analyst (LBA; sometimes called a licensed applied behavior analyst or LABA). Learn more
